NHTSA Administrator Mark Rosekind Will Provide Keynote Address at SAE International 2015 Government/Industry Meeting
WARRENDALE, Pa. (PRWEB) January 20, 2015 -- Mark R. Rosekind, PhD, Administrator of the National Traffic Safety Highway Administration (NHTSA) will provide the keynote address on Wednesday, Jan. 21 at the 2015 Government/Industry Meeting, which will be held Jan. 21-23, 2015, at the Walter E. Washington Convention Center in Washington, D.C.
Dr. Rosekind will speak at 9 a.m. in Room 145 AB.
The event is hosted by Daimler and will be co-located with the Washington Auto Show. The meeting’s theme will be “Future Vehicles: Integrating Safety, Environment and the Technology.”
Administrator Rosekind was sworn in at the 15th NHTSA Administrator on Dec. 22, 2014. In his role as Administrator, Dr. Rosekind pursues NHTSA’s core safety mission of saving lives, preventing injuries, and reducing crashes through all of the tools at NHTSA’s disposal—including enforcement authority, public awareness campaigns, support of technical innovation, and research into human behavior.
The SAE Government/Industry Meeting focuses on understanding how technology, regulations and legislation affect the design of light and heavy duty vehicles in terms of safety, environment and energy conservation. The technical program will include a multitude of relevant topics facing industry and regulatory professionals, including environmental, energy conservation and safety.
